Last night we headed to the West End Ritz for the N Street Village 40th Anniversary Gala.

We snapped Honorary Steering Committee co-chairs MO Senator Roy Blunt and his wife Abigail Blunt with Altria’s John Hoel. The inspiring gala had women from N Street programs performing with the band.

Former Studley head Steve Goldstein, former Mayor Anthony Williams, Ambassador Council founder Sunny Alsup, and Unicorn’s Eugene Dewitt Kinlow at the cocktail reception before dinner.

Senators Kelly Ayotte and Kay Hagan were the night’s honorees along with three women who changed their lives through N Street’s programs. Here, i Ricchi owner Christianne Ricchi, Carol Wheeler (wife of FCC chairman Tom Wheeler), and Comcast’s Melissa Maxfield are bookended by Salon Ilo’s Aaron Lichtman and Gary Walker.

Mayor Gray came to support N Street, and hear uplifting performances by Sweet Honey in the Rock and Ambassadors of Praise. Last year, N Street changed the lives of 1,400 homeless and low-income DC women.
